Is it possible to rebuild trust after having broken up?
Fortunately, yes. It’s definitely possible to rebuild trust after a breakup, but it takes time, effort, and commitment from both partners.
Rebuilding trust is a process that requires both partners to be honest, open, and willing to work through the issues that led to the breakdown of trust.
If you’ve broken the trust of your ex girlfriend then you’re going to have to take responsibility for your actions, show remorse, and be willing to make amends.
You need to be willing to listen to your ex girlfriend's feelings and concerns, and be open to feedback.
Rebuilding trust takes time and it may not happen overnight. It requires patience, consistency, and a commitment to making things right. And remember that rebuilding trust is a process that requires effort from both partners and it's not guaranteed. You can only do so much, if your ex girlfriend is unwilling to listen it will be hard to regain their trust.

Do the reasons for the breakup make a difference?
The reasons for the breakup have a huge influence in the process of regaining an ex girlfriend's trust. Some reasons for a breakup may require different approaches, and they have different levels of difficulty. Here are some of the common reasons for breakups and loss of trust:
Infidelity: Infidelity is one of the most common reasons for a breakup and one of the most difficult reasons to regain trust. It can take a lot of time and effort to regain an ex girlfriend's trust after infidelity, as it can cause deep hurt and damage to the relationship.
Lack of Communication: Lack of communication may be easier to address and may require less time to regain trust, as it may not have caused as much emotional pain as infidelity. However, it's important to address the underlying reasons for the lack of communication and make sure that it does not happen again in the future.
Financial Issues: Financial issues can also be a major cause of trust issues in a relationship. Addressing financial concerns and making a plan for how to handle them can be a step in regaining trust.
Addiction: Addiction causes trust issues in a relationship. Addressing these issues and seeking help may be necessary before rebuilding trust.
Past traumas or insecurities: If there were past traumas or insecurities during the relationship then they could have built up and lead to trust issues. Addressing these underlying issues may be necessary before rebuilding trust.
It's important to understand the specific reason for the breakdown of trust in a relationship and work towards addressing it.

The difficulty of regaining trust after a breakup
Regaining trust after a breakup takes patience, effort, and time. A few factors that make regaining trust difficult after a breakup include:
Past hurt and betrayal: Trust issues that have led to a breakup can be deeply ingrained, and it may be difficult for an ex girlfriend to forget past hurt and betrayal.
Distrust: When trust is broken, it can be difficult for an ex-partner to trust again. They may be skeptical about the sincerity of the apology, and may question the motives behind the effort to regain trust.
Fear of being hurt again: After a breakup, an ex girlfriend may be hesitant to trust again because they are afraid of being hurt. They may be guarded and cautious, which makes it difficult for them to open up and trust again.
Lack of consistency: Regaining trust requires consistency, and if the person who broke the trust, fails to follow through on their promises or shows inconsistency in their actions, it can be difficult to regain trust.
Time: Trust takes time to build, and it also takes time to regain after it has been broken. Even if an ex girlfriend is willing to forgive and trust again, it may take a while for them to fully regain trust.
Understanding why trust was lost
Self reflection on what led to trust being broken
Self-reflection on your own actions is an important step in understanding why trust was lost in a relationship and regaining it.
It’s a process of looking inward and examining your own behaviors, and how they may have contributed to the breakdown of trust.
During this process, it's important to be honest with yourself and not make excuses. As a strong man you need to take responsibility and understand that what you’ve done in the past has consequences.
There’s no hiding from it, and it can be uncomfortable to face your own mistakes and admit that you’ve hurt someone. But it’s necessary if you really want to recover from this situation and get an ex girlfriend back.
Self-reflection can involve asking yourself questions like:
- What did I do that led to the trust being broken?
- How did my actions affect my girlfriend and the relationship?
- What can I learn from this experience?
- How can I make sure that this doesn’t happen again in the future?
Keep in mind that self-reflection shouldn’t be used to blame yourself for the entire breakdown of the relationship. Both parties likely had a role to play in this.
But taking responsibility for your own actions and learning from mistakes helps to make sure they don’t happen again in the future.

Take responsibility for your actions
A genuine apology
Crafting a genuine apology is an important step in regaining trust after a trust has been broken.
An apology should be heartfelt and sincere, and show that you understand and take responsibility for your actions. Here are some tips for crafting a genuine apology:
Acknowledge the specific actions that led to trust being broken: Instead of making general or vague statements, be specific about what you did wrong and how it affected your partner.
Take full responsibility for your actions: Be a man and front up to this issue. Avoid making excuses or placing blame on others.
Show remorse: Express true remorse for the hurt you caused. Show that you understand the impact of your actions and that you regret them.
Offer a plan for rebuilding trust: Show that you’re committed to making things right and rebuilding trust. Offer a specific plan for how you will work towards regaining your partner's trust.
Ask for forgiveness: Ask for forgiveness and give your partner the opportunity to express their feelings and emotions. Show that you are willing to listen and make amends.
Follow through: Follow through with your plan for rebuilding trust and be consistent in your actions. Show that you are truly remorseful and committed to making things right.

Giving your ex girlfriend space
Importance of time and space
Allowing your ex girlfriend time to process and heal after trust has been broken is important. They need space to assess things and they don’t want to be suffocated with constant messages and apologies.
It shows respect: Giving your ex-girlfriend space shows that you respect her feelings and that you understand that she needs time to process and heal. It demonstrates that you are willing to put her needs first and that you are committed to rebuilding trust.
It helps to prevent pushing too hard: When trust has been broken, it can be tempting to push for forgiveness and reconciliation too quickly. However, this can be overwhelming and can make the healing process more difficult. Giving your ex-girlfriend space allows her to process her feelings and emotions at her own pace.
It allows for perspective: Time and distance can give both partners a sense of perspective on the relationship and what went wrong. It can help them to understand the reasons for the breakdown of trust and to develop a plan for rebuilding it.
It allows for healing: Trust is a fragile thing and when it is broken it can take time to heal. Giving your ex-girlfriend space allows her to process her emotions and to heal from the hurt that was caused.
It allows for rebuilding trust: After the space and time, when both partners are ready, it allows for rebuilding trust by starting with small steps and building it gradually. This process can take time, but it is essential for the long-term health of the relationship.
Tips for respecting boundaries
Respecting boundaries is crucial in any relationship, but especially when trust has been broken. It allows both partners to feel safe and secure, and it is an important step in rebuilding trust. Here are some tips for respecting boundaries:
Communicate clearly: Communicate clearly with your ex-girlfriend about what boundaries she needs and what you are willing to do to respect them. This can include things like giving her space and time to process, not contacting her too frequently, or avoiding certain topics of conversation.
Be attentive to body language: Pay attention to your ex girlfriend's body language and nonverbal cues. If she seems uncomfortable or closes off, it's important to respect her boundaries and give her space.
Show empathy: Show empathy towards your ex-girlfriend's feelings and emotions. Understand that the breakdown of trust has likely caused her pain and that respecting her boundaries is an important step in helping her to heal.
Follow through: Once boundaries have been established, it's important to follow through and respect them. This means not pushing or crossing boundaries, even if it's difficult or uncomfortable.
Be willing to compromise: Be willing to compromise and make adjustments to boundaries as needed. Be open to feedback and be willing to adjust boundaries as the relationship progresses and trust is rebuilt.
Be consistent: Be consistent in respecting boundaries. Show that you are committed to rebuilding trust and that you are willing to put in the effort to respect your ex-girlfriend's boundaries.
